Defining the survivor validation flow

Procedure

  1. Double-click tRuleSurvivorship to open its Basic settings view.
  2. Click the Sync columns button to retrieve the schema from the previous component.
  3. From the list, select the column to be used as a Group Identifier.
  4. In the Rule package name field, enter the name of the rule package you need to create to define the survivor validation flow of interest, org.talend.survivorship.sample in this example.
  5. In the Rule table, click the [+] button to add as many rows as required and complete them using the corresponding rule definitions.
  6. Next to Generate rules and survivorship flow, click the icon to generate the rule package with its contents you have defined.

    You can find the generated rule package in the Metadata > Rules Management > Survivorship Rules directory of Talend Studio Repository. From there, you can open the survivor validation flow created in this example and read its diagram.
